Function Introduction:
The production process is as follows: fresh leaf conveying (vertical conveying) → vertical cutting → horizontal cutting . Due to the inconsistent sizes of mechanical plucking leaves, issues such as uneven steam fixation may arise. Additionally, excessively long tea stems hinder the subsequent stem-leaf separation process and may cause blockages, so it is essential to cut the fresh leaves.
Product Working Principle
This fresh leaf cutters utilizes the relative motion between the drive shaft blade and the driven shaft blade, achieving the cutting purpose through their speed difference and blade spacing. The raw material is machine-cut leaves, less than 200mm in length, without lignified tea stems. The fresh leaves are cut into small segments ranging from 25mm to 50mm in length.
1.vertical type fresh tea leaf cutter specification:
| Model | VTC-150 |
| Machine dimension(L*W*H) | 720*700*720mm |
| Roller cutter diameter | Φ150 |
| Maximum speed of active roller cutter | 210 r/mim |
| Motor | 2.2kw ,380V,3phase |
| Hourly fresh leaf processing capacity | ≥500kg/h |
| First cut rate | ≥95% |
2.Transverse type fresh tea leaf cutter specification:
| Model | TTC-135 |
| Machine dimension(L*W*H) | 720*700*720mm |
| Roller cutter diameter | Φ130 |
| Maximum speed of active roller cutter | 840r/min |
| Motor | 2.2kw ,380V,3phase |
| Hourly fresh leaf processing capacity | ≥500kg/h |
| First cut rate | ≥95% |
